"I have eaten at various Chinese Restaurants in my life and I am almost 70 years old. The best place by far is Shan Shan Low off Willow Pass Road in Concord. The food is fresh and good.... and I have eaten there for the past 28+ years, but I decided to venture out this eve with the wife and she chose Yan 's Garden. Regarding Yan 's Garden Chinese Rest (2223 Morello Ave, PH, CA), I had the worst experience yet today after spending $50+ on the food for the wife and myself.... I will never be back. The food was disgusting. My lemon chicken if that is what you call it.... was chewy, old, and cold; gave it to my dog (literally). The butter something lemon that you pour over it was like drinking butter.... no lemon flavor. My side order of Fried Prawns was a joke. I can tell real home made prawns versus from a box. These prawns were the cheap freezer box type and not fresh, and cooked up very gross. That said, my rice was fine but it is difficult to screw that up; the pot stickers were ok . My hot and sour soup needed improvement. Was not hot and sour like the other restaurants and had something in it I could not tell what it was but it ruin the soup. I do not understand what the problem was aside from being cheap quality. The place was literally empty when I came in. It only had the front girl with her kids playing in the empty restaurant... and I heard a few others in the back. Oh yes, this restaurant is the only Chinese facility I have ever gone to that does (not) serve hot tea. Yes, she said they did not have tea. Unreal! There is more but I am done. Do not need anymore stress after paying over $50 for frozen boxed food."
